# Refrigerator drawer repair

Drawer units carry their whole seal on a moving part, so alignment, runner wear and gasket compression cause more warm-drawer calls than any refrigeration component does.

How it presents
- One drawer holding temperature while the other runs warm
- Drawer front standing proud of the cabinetry on one side
- Drawer dragging, grinding or refusing to close the last inch
- Condensation or frost around the drawer opening
- Warm air felt at the top edge of the closed drawer
- Unit running constantly in an island with restricted airflow

What gets checked, in order
- Measure each drawer separately against its own setpoint
- Inspect runner travel through the full stroke for binding and lift
- Check gasket compression along all four sides of each drawer
- Confirm the panel weight and handle mounting have not pulled the front out of plane
- Inspect the bottom grille and condenser for restriction
- Verify the drain path is clear and unfrozen

Refrigerator drawers are the only refrigeration product where the entire door seal travels on a mechanism. A hinged door pivots on two fixed points and the gasket meets a flat face. A drawer carries its gasket out into the room and back on a pair of runners, with a heavy custom panel and a handle hanging off the front of it. Everything about the failure profile follows from that.

## One drawer warm, one drawer fine

This is the classic drawer complaint and it is rarely a refrigeration fault. Two drawers in the same cabinet usually share air from one evaporator. If one holds temperature and the other does not, the air is arriving and the difference is at the seal or in the drawer’s own sensing.

We measure both drawers independently, then look along the gasket with the drawer closed. A gasket that has taken a compression set on the top edge, common where a handle is used to pull the drawer shut off-centre for ten years, will let a steady stream of room air in at the top while the sides still look perfect. That produces a drawer that reads five to eight degrees warm and never recovers, and produces frost around the opening in humid weather, which Northeast Florida supplies for most of the year.

## Runners are consumables

Full-extension runners carrying a hardwood or stainless panel, a solid brass handle and forty pounds of contents wear. They do not usually fail outright. They develop lift at the end of travel, which tilts the drawer front a few degrees and lifts the top of the gasket off its face. The customer describes it as the drawer not closing properly. The refrigeration effect is a warm drawer.

Runner replacement, re-shimming and panel realignment are the most common work on this product. It is unglamorous and it fixes more drawers than any electrical part.

## Alignment after cabinetry work

We see a spike in drawer calls after kitchen refreshes. New panel stock is heavier than the original, or a handle is moved further from the centreline, or a filler strip is added and the unit is pushed a quarter inch out of square in its opening. All three shift the seal. If your drawers began behaving differently within a few weeks of a remodel, tell us on the phone; it changes what we bring.

## Airflow in an island

Drawer units are frequently specified for islands, which is where their low profile earns its keep and where their airflow suffers most. The condenser is at the bottom behind a front grille. If a stone overhang, a decorative panel or a run of trim has narrowed that opening, the unit runs longer, holds less well in August, and recovers in November. Cleaning schedule is six to twelve months, halved with pets, not needed on a unit under six months old.

## Drains and frost

Drawer cabinets have a drain and it can freeze. As everywhere else in this product family, the blockage is ice far more often than debris. Nothing rigid goes down that tube and boiling water does not go into it, because the drain heater and evaporator pan sit on the other side. A controlled defrost with the drawers open clears the ice; finding out why it froze is the actual repair.
